Generation: 1

  1. 1.  Agnes Mary Denise Ruddock was born on 9 Oct 1893 in Ardeley, Hertfordshire (daughter of Mark Ernest Ruddock, (Rev) and Annie Josphine Scott); died on 24 Jul 1978 in Cirencester, Gloucestershire; was buried in Jul 1978 in Ampney St Peter, Gloucestershire.

    Agnes married The Rev. Francis Antony Woodard Gibbs on 27 Jun 1923 in Ardeley, Hertfordshire. Francis (son of Henry Martin Gibbs, High Sheriff, Somerset and Emily Anna Otter) was born on 17 Dec 1885 in Barrow Court, Barrow Gurney, Somerset; died on 3 Aug 1946 in Fairford, Gloucestershire.     Children:
    1. Emily Matilda Jean Gibbs was born on 13 Dec 1924 in Walkern, Hertfordshire; died on 7 Jul 2002.
    2. Anne Denise Perpetua Gibbs, JP was born on 7 Mar 1926 in Walkern, Hertfordshire; died on 15 Apr 1992 in Westminster, London.
    3. Major Henry Francis Gibbs was born on 23 Jun 1928 in The Rectory, Walkern, Hertfordshire; died on 3 Feb 2020.
    4. Caroline Mary Blanche Gibbs was born on 8 Aug 1932 in Walken, Hertfordshire; died on 27 Feb 1965 in Rhodes; was buried in Ampney St Peter, Gloucestershire.
